The Texas Instruments TLV320AIC21IPFBR is a low-power, highly-integrated, programmable 16-bit dual-channel CODEC. It supports stereo 16-bit oversampling Sigma-Delta A/D and D/A converters, with selectable FIR/IIR filters.
Key electrical specifications include a 16-bit resolution, dynamic range of 87/92 dB for ADCs and DACs respectively, and an SNR of 84/92 dB. The device operates with a voltage range of 2.7V to 3.6V and has a programmable sampling rate up to 26 kSPS. It supports a maximum master clock of 100 MHz and features power management modes with low power consumption.
This CODEC is designed for applications such as wireless accessories, hands-free car kits, and VoIP systems. It is fully compatible with common DSP families and microcontrollers, offering a glueless 4-wire interface. The device operates within a temperature range of -40°C to 85°C.
The TLV320AIC21IPFBR comes in a 48-TQFP (7x7) surface mount package, making it suitable for compact designs.
